GPS positioning continues while measuring, and when
positioning is complete the device starts recording
positional information. The routes before GPS
positioning is complete and while using indoor mode
are not recorded. For SF-710 and SF-510, distance and
pace data can still be measured. The device will use the
stride sensor until a GPS connection is made.

Indoor mode (SF-710/SF-510
only)
This function allows you to measure without
performing GPS positioning. Use this when GPS
positioning cannot be performed because you are
indoors and so on.
The route and so on is not recorded in indoor mode.
Also, measurement items are limited in indoor mode.
"Measurable Items" on page 34
U
Use either of the following methods to enter indoor
mode.
❏ Hold down C on the time screen
❏ If GPS positioning fails, select Indoor on the screen
displayed
